Do not drive and/or ride in the vehicle with  
the seatback reclined. This can be danger-  
ous. The shoulder belt will not be properly  
against the body. In an accident, you and  
your passengers could be thrown into the  
shoulder belt and receive neck or other  
serious injuries. You and your passengers  
could also slide under the lap belt and  
receive serious injuries.  
Do not adjust the drivers seat while driving so  
that full attention may be given to vehicle  
operation.

After adjusting a seat, gently shake the seat to  
confirm that the seat is locked securely. If the  
seat is not locked securely, it may move  
suddenly and could cause the loss of control of  
the vehicle.  
.
For the most effective protection while the  
vehicle is in motion, the seatback should be  
upright. Always sit well back in the seat and  
adjust the seat belt properly. (See Seat  
belts(P.1-7).)  
CAUTION:  
When adjusting the seat positions, be sure not  
to contact any moving parts to avoid possible  
injuries and/or damages.

The battery could run down if the seat heater  
is operated while the engine is not running.  
Do not use the seat heater for extended  
periods or when no one is using the seat.  
Properly secure all luggage to help prevent it  
from sliding or shifting. Do not place lug-  
gage higher than the seatbacks.  
Do not put anything on the seat which  
insulates heat, such as a blanket, cushion,  
seat cover, etc. Otherwise, the seat may  
become overheated.  
When returning the seatbacks to the upright  
position, be certain they are completely  
secured in the latched position. If they are  
not completely secured, passengers may be  
injured in an accident or sudden stop.  
.
Do not place anything hard or heavy on the  
seat or pierce it with a pin or similar object.  
This may result in damage to the seat heater.
